### Audit Item 14 — Query Planner Regression

Check that the Bramblewick planner rollback (v3.2 → v3.1 join ordering) didn't quietly reopen the predicate-pushdown hole we patched last quarter. Run the adversarial query suite, eyeball the EXPLAIN output for the tenants table, and confirm row-level filters still apply pre-join. Flag anything weird. The engineer on the hook for this item is named below.

approver of yahif-kawef = Quenix Fraath

Welcome to the Scanline team at Orvetta Retail. Our barcode scanner integration runs through the Pellton gateway service, which decodes EAN and QR payloads before inventory sync. New hires need access to the staging decoder vault on day one. To unlock it, use the recovery passphrase below.

vault phrase of tajop-haduf = holath-brivan-wenax

**Step 7 — Upgrade Quillbus to 3.x**

Drain all consumers on the Quillbus broker before stopping the service; in-flight acknowledgments are not preserved across the 2.x to 3.x boundary. After installing 3.1, run the schema migrator against the broker's metadata store — it rewrites the offsets table in place, so take a snapshot first. The migrator reads the metadata store via the connection string below.

replica DSN, kajep-yahag: mssql://praok_svc:iF@db-8d68.plorvaio.local:5432/eliion